Following other airlines, Delta Air Lines will require passengers to keep their seat belts fastened at all times while they are seated during flight. The airline will implement the rule this summer.

"Delta has for decades recommended that its passengers keep their seat belts fastened while seated during flight. This simple procedure greatly reduces the changes a passenger will be injured if the flight encounters undetected turbulence," said Delta Air Lines Chief Operating Officer Maurice Worth.
